Twitter will now allow its users to listen to songs, podcasts and other audio content in their timelines within the Twitter app, while they continue to scroll through other tweets.

The micro blogging site has rolled out a new version of its Audio Cards with SoundCloud and Apple as launch partners on Thursday this week. The feature will showcase the new experience with music tweets from the Foo Fighters, David Guetta and Chance the Rapper.

With the help of this update meant for Twitter’s iOS and Android apps, users will now be able to expand the audio card for more details or dock the audio player with one swipe, which will not create any hindrance while they browse through their timelines. Earlier, users had to leave that audio tweet or open the audio file in a browser to continue browsing their timeline.

The primary third-party partner of this feature at its launch is SoundCloud and so every SoundCloud link in a tweet can be played and docked. However, as of now, only a few SoundCloud creators have access to the feature.
